Gameplay: Fast, Fluid, and Addictive

The core gameplay loop is refreshingly snappy. Matches are quick (usually under 10 minutes), the movement feels responsive, and the shooting mechanics — while simplified compared to AAA titles — have genuine skill expression. Slide-hopping (chaining slides and jumps) gives experienced players a distinct movement advantage, adding a skill ceiling that keeps things competitive.

There are multiple game modes including:

  • Free For All — Classic deathmatch, every player for themselves.
  • Team Deathmatch — Two teams fighting for the highest kill count.
  • Capture the Flag — Objective-based mode requiring coordination.
  • Parkour — A non-combat mode focused purely on movement challenges.

Classes and Customization

Krunker.io features a class system with distinct playstyles. The Hunter snipes from range, the Runner moves at blinding speed, and the Triggerman is your all-around assault rifle class. This variety keeps the game feeling fresh across sessions.

Cosmetic customization is extensive — weapon skins, player skins, and hats can be traded or earned. None of this affects gameplay, which is a big plus for fairness.

Performance in the Browser

This is where Krunker.io genuinely impresses. Running at a smooth framerate in most modern browsers, it doesn't feel like a "lesser" version of a real FPS. The art style — blocky and colorful — is well-suited to the browser environment and keeps performance high even on modest hardware.

Who Is It For?

Krunker.io is ideal for anyone who wants a quick, competitive gaming fix without the commitment of installing a full game client. It's great for lunch-break gaming, office downtime, or just scratching that FPS itch on the fly. Hardcore competitive FPS players may find it too simplistic, but casual and mid-core players will find plenty to enjoy.
